Northland Power, Inc. engages in electricity production from renewable resources such as wind, solar, and clean-burning natural gas. The company is headquartered in Toronto, Ontario. The firm is developing, owning and operating a diversified mix of energy infrastructure assets including offshore and onshore wind, solar, battery energy storage, and natural gas, as well as supplying energy through a regulated utility. Its facilities produce electricity from clean-burning natural gas and renewable resources such as wind and solar. The Company’s segments include offshore wind facilities, onshore renewable facilities, natural gas facilities, and utilities. The company owns or has an economic interest in approximately 3.5 GW of gross operating generating capacity, 2.2 GW under construction. Its projects include Baltic Power-Offshore Wind, ScotWind - Scottish Offshore Wind, Oneida Energy Storage, Jurassic Solar+ - Alberta Solar, Hai Long - Taiwanese Offshore Wind, High Bridge - New York Onshore Wind. The firm owns two BESS projects totaling over 300 MW /1.2 GWh in Poland.

As of August 2026, Northland Power Inc (Ontario) NPIFF is classified as not halal according to Musaffa’s Shariah screening methodology. This classification is based on an assessment of the company’s business activities and financial ratios against Islamic investment guidelines.
A stock is Shariah-compliant if the company operates in permissible business activities and meets Islamic financial screening thresholds. Musaffa analyzes Northland Power Inc (Ontario) using these criteria to determine its compliance status.
Muslim investors may consider investing in Northland Power Inc (Ontario) if it meets Shariah compliance standards. Investors typically review the company’s business activities, debt levels, and non-permissible income before making a decision.
Musaffa determines the Shariah status of Northland Power Inc (Ontario) by analyzing whether the company’s core business operations are permissible and whether its financial ratios fall within accepted Islamic thresholds.
The Shariah compliance status of Northland Power Inc (Ontario) may be updated periodically when new financial statements, earnings reports, or business activity information become available.
Yes. A stock that is currently Shariah-compliant may become non-compliant if the company’s financial ratios exceed Shariah thresholds or its business activities change.
